Key Products to Include

Serums: Types and benefits for different skin concerns. Moisturizers: Choosing the right formulation for your skin type.

Many ladies want glowing skin at night. To achieve this, including the right products is important. Start with serums. They help with specific skin problems. For example, vitamin C serum brightens skin. Hyaluronic acid keeps it hydrated. Next, choose a suitable moisturizer. Consider your skin type: oily, dry, or combination. A light gel works for oily skin, while creamy lotions suit dry skin. Don’t forget to test products before use!

What types of serums are best for skin concerns?

Vitamin C, hyaluronic acid, and retinol are some of the best serums. They target various skin issues like dryness or aging.

Tips for choosing a moisturizer:

  • Oily skin: Use a lightweight gel.
  • Dry skin: Look for creamy formulas.
  • Combination skin: Find a balance between both types.

Targeting Specific Skin Issues

Acne: Best ingredients and product recommendations. Aging: Antiaging products and their effectiveness.

Dealing with acne? Look for products with salicylic acid or benzoyl peroxide. They tackle stubborn pimples like a superhero! Moisturizers with oil-free formulas can keep skin hydrated without adding more breakouts. For aging skin, use retinol. It helps reduce fine lines and brings back that youthful glow! Paired with vitamin C serums, your skin will feel fresher than a daisy. Here’s a helpful table to guide your choices:

Skin Issue Best Ingredients Recommended Products
Acne Salicylic Acid, Benzoyl Peroxide Neutrogena Oil-Free Acne Wash, La Roche-Posay Effaclar Duo
Aging Retinol, Vitamin C Olay Regenerist Retinol 24, CeraVe Vitamin C Serum

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Overexfoliating: Risks and how to avoid. Skipping sunscreen: Importance of daytime protection.

Many women aim for glowing skin at night, but some common missteps can derail their efforts. First, be careful not to overexfoliate. This can lead to irritation and redness, like a pizza that’s been left in the oven too long—crispy, but not in a good way! To avoid this, limit exfoliation to 2-3 times a week.

Next, skipping sunscreen in the morning is a big no-no! Even if you think your skin is safe at night, sunlight can sneak up on you. Think of sunscreen as your daily superhero cape, protecting you from harmful UV rays. It’s essential for healthy skin.

Common Mistakes Tips to Avoid
Overexfoliating Limit exfoliation to 2-3 times a week
Skipping Sunscreen Always apply sunscreen in the morning

How do I know my skin type?

To determine your skin type, wash your face, wait an hour, and observe. If your skin feels tight, it might be dry. If it shines, it’s likely oily. Combination skin shows both traits.

How Do Different Skin Types (Oily, Dry, Combination, Sensitive) Affect The Choice Of Night Skincare Products?

Different skin types need special care at night. If you have oily skin, look for light creams that won’t make your skin greasier. For dry skin, use thicker lotions that help lock in moisture. If your skin is a mix, you may need to use two different products for each area. For sensitive skin, pick gentle, calming products with fewer harsh ingredients.

What Specific Ingredients Should Women Look For In Night Creams And Serums For Anti-Aging Benefits?

When looking for night creams and serums, you should check for a few special ingredients. Look for retinol; it helps your skin look fresh. Hyaluronic acid keeps your skin soft and hydrated. Vitamin C brightens your skin and helps with dark spots. Lastly, peptides support skin’s strength and smoothness. These ingredients can make your skin look younger and healthier.
